A single slit forms a diffraction pattern,with the first minimum at an angle of 40.0° from central maximum,when monochromatic light of 630-nm wavelength is used.The same slit,illuminated by a new monochromatic light source,produces a diffraction pattern with the second minimum at a 60.0° angle from the central maximum.What is the wavelength of this new light?
